II. Common Concerns and Solutions
1. Installation Challenges
Problème: Installing LED strips discreetly (e.g., behind bookshelves, walls, or artwork) without visible wiring.
Solutions:
-
- Hidden Installation Techniques:
-
- Use U-shaped aluminum channels to conceal strips and diffuse light.
-
- Opt for adhesive-backed strips with industrial-grade 3M tape.
-
- Secure strips in recessed areas using magnetic tracks.
-
- Pro Tip: Create a layout blueprint to avoid gaps or overlapping light zones.

2. Brightness and Color Consistency
Problème: Inconsistent brightness or color temperatures between layers.
Solutions:
-
- Uniform Light Distribution:
-
- Angle strips at 45–60 degrees toward reflective surfaces (e.g., walls).
-
- Use high-CRI (90+) strips for accurate color rendering.
-
- Dimming Controls:
-
- Pair with smart dimmers or DMX controllers for precise adjustments.
-
- Select strips from the same production batch for color consistency.
3. Safety and Heat Management
Problème: Overheating risks in enclosed spaces.
Solutions:
-
- Dissipation de la chaleur:
-
- Install strips on aluminum profiles (heat sinks) instead of PVC channels.
-
- Use active cooling (e.g., small fans) for high-power strips (>14W/m).
-
- Safety Checks:
-
- Choisir IP65/IP67-rated strips for humid areas.
-
- Inspect connections regularly for exposed wires or adhesive failure.

4. Power and Electrical Load
Problème: Overloaded circuits or voltage drop.
Solutions:
-
- Power Supply Sizing:
-
- Calculate total wattage:
Total Length (m) × Wattage per Meter × 1.2 (safety buffer).
- Calculate total wattage:
-
- Use 60W/100W/200W drivers based on load requirements.
-
- Voltage Drop Mitigation:
-
- For runs >5 meters, inject power from both ends or use 24V strips.
-
- Add signal amplifiers for RGB/RGBW strips in long installations.
5. Durability and Maintenance
Problème: Premature fading, flickering, or failure.
Solutions:
-
- Quality Selection:
-
- Choisir copper-clad PCB strips for better conductivity.
-
- Opt for IP68 silicone-coated strips for outdoor/high-moisture areas.
-
- Maintenance Routine:
-
- Clean strips every 3–6 months with a dry microfiber cloth.
-
- Replace failing segments using connecteurs sans soudure.
III. Creative Applications
1. Ambient Lighting
Transform living spaces with indirect illumination:
- Ceiling Coving: Use warm-white strips (2700K–3000K) for a "floating ceiling" effect.
- Under-Bed Lighting: Install dimmable strips for nighttime pathways.
2. Decorative Lighting
Highlight architectural or artistic elements:
- Bookshelf Accents: Add RGB strips behind shelves for dynamic color.
- Artwork Illumination: Frame paintings with low-profile, high-CRI strips.
3. Smart Home Integration
Enhance convenience and energy efficiency:
- Voice/Automation Control: Sync with Google Home, Alexa, or Apple HomeKit.
- Scene Setting: Program presets like "Movie Night" (dimmed amber) or "Morning Wake-Up" (cool white).
